This cutaway 12-fret Grand Concert delivers a playing experience that blends physical comfort with surprising warmth and tonal power for a compact body. The 12-fret neck-to-body relationship shifts the bridge position on the soundboard, where it articulates the top in a way that produces more midrange punch. The rosewood/Lutz spruce wood pairing yields a pleasing blend of sonic detail and dynamic range.
The Grand Concert body makes for a clear, responsive voice that fingerstyle players will love, along with the hand-friendly 24-7/8-inch scale length. The compact body also keeps the overtones in check, making this a great choice for recording or the stage, especially with Taylor’s natural-sounding onboard ES2 acoustic electronics. Wood-rich appointments include Hawaiian koa binding, a herringbone-style rosette featuring Douglas fir with maple/black accents, and bias-cut Douglas fir top trim, while the “weathered brown” pickguard design complements the earthy color tones of the rosewood and wood trim.
